"A blend of cabernet sauvignon 53%, merlot 27% and cabernet franc 20%. Dense and powerful with a great texture. Quite a plush wine with dark berries, chocolate/mocha, ferrous, spice and nutty oak. Long and layered with a core of sweet fruit Very impressive" Bob Campbell, Master of Wine, Real Review, Jun 2022

"The colour is intense and dark, opaque with dark purple hues and a purple ruby rim. Aromas of concentration and intensity with blackberries and roasted plums, tobacco and cigar scents with a toasty barrel and baking spices complexity. Full-bodied and complex, intense, fruity, toasty and young. Flavours mirror the bouquet and drive the palate core; oak, firm tannins and medium+acidity layer in foundation textures and added mouthfeel. A delicious wine, a classic wine, lengthy, rich, complex and very new-world Hawkes Bay. Excting. Best drinking from 2025 or older through 2040" Cameron Douglas, Master Sommelier, Sep 2022

"Deep, dense ruby-red, slightly lighter on the rim. The nose is enticing, complex, and gently full, with penetrating aromas of cassis, blackberry and young plum entwined with blackcurrant leaf, tobacco leaf, cedar, violet, vanilla and nutmeg. Full-bodied, elegant aromas of cassis, blackberry and red plum form a tenacious core, unveiling blackcurrant leaf, menthol, violet, cedar, tobacco, vanilla, nutmeg and clove. The wine is complex; multilayers of flavour unfold as it aerates. The fruit is perfume, with an excellent balance of ripeness and concentration. Tightly knitted fine-grained tannin provides structure, vitality and excellent cellaring potential. This is a remarkably vibrant and densely packed Cabernet Merlot blend with complex flavour layers, stylish oak and a structured palate. Match with porterhouse and venison over the next 15+ years" Candice Chow, Raymon Chan Wine Reviews, Sep 2022

A complex aroma of cassis, black currant, and black Doris plum, fresh tobacco, cocoa powder hints of oyster shell, floral violet, cardamom, and clove and an intriguing sous bois and sanguine note. The palate has great structure and layers of complexity of flavour. A silky textured attack with a plush concentrated cassis and blackberry palate, with ripe Black Doris plum cocoa powder and spice flavours on the mid palate, a hint of mineral elegance expressed as oyster shell with a long flavored fine grained tannin finish. This wine will improve with cellaring. Recommended drinking from 2022 till 2042 (and beyond).

A blend of 53% Cabernet Sauvignon, 27% Merlot & 20% Cabernet Franc.

Sub blocks are selected at our Maraekakaho vineyard to grow low yielding crops. Management for our high tier wines starts with pruning. The vines are manicured from then onwards, with crop thinning to one bunch per cane and a manual leaf-pluck pre veraison. The canopy is kept open to provide for airflow and sun exposure. At optimum ripeness we hand harvest selected rows.

Whole bunches are de-stemmed and the berries are then sorted using our optical grape sorter, then crushed to a closed fermenter. After a period of cold soak we inoculate with preferred yeast. Temperatures are then managed to reach about 30°C. Once the ferment is dry the wine is tasted to evaluate maceration time, and finally basket pressed to barrel. Barrels are stored in temperature controlled rooms. We aim for about 50% new French oak barriques. Elevage in barrel can take up to 24 months or more. Final barrel selection and blending takes place about 8 weeks before bottling. The wine is bottled after filtration.
